Emma Heming Willis is willing to die hard on the hill of her husband Bruce Willis ’ health.
One week after the 47-year-old revealed the Sixth Sense actor is living in a separate home to receive around-the-clock care for frontotemporal dementia (FTD), she responded to criticism over the update, standing by the decision she made to prioritize his needs.
"Dementia plays out differently in everyone's home and you have to do what's right for your family dynamic and what's right for your person," Emma told People in an interview published Sept. 3. "It's heartbreaking to me. But this is how we were able to support our whole family, [and] it has opened up Bruce's world."
